Output d340a0890d6d5505c5a3ecee0001b9626ce6d9c4eae2093f12d65628731d5137:0

value
6053572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c5dadcb50ea0de47451723ebd7bb5e47766d96 OP_EQUAL
address
3QThCWbYUPkCkLWg1nhLrvQvpraP4vYyeb
transaction
d340a0890d6d5505c5a3ecee0001b9626ce6d9c4eae2093f12d65628731d5137
spent
true